管理进程并设置计划运行的任务
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
管理进程并设置计划运行的任务
案例需求
——为了更好的了解和控制Linux服务器的有序运行,需要管理员对进程管理和计划任务设置相关操作进行熟悉,以完成相应的服务运行维护任务
需求描述
管理系统中的进程
确认vsftpd、sshd服务的启动状态,并关闭vsftpd服务
启动bluetooth服务,然后使用kill命令终止其运行
查找系统中CPU占用率超过80的进程,并强行终止该进程
设置计划运行的系统管理任务
每周一早上7:50自动清空FTP服务器公共目录“/var/ftp/pub”
每天晚上10:30分自动执行任务,保存磁盘使用情况信息
查看所设置的计划任务列表
实现思路
确认vsftpd、sshd服务的启动状态,使用service命令关闭vsftps服务
启动系统中的Bluetooth服务,确认服务状态,并使用ps命令查看相关进程的详细信息
使用kill命令终止Bluetooth服务程序中进程的运行,再次确认服务状态,最后使用service 命令关闭Bluetooth服务程序
使用cpuburn-in工具模拟CPU过载
查找相应进程
杀死相应的进程
再次查看
设置计划运行的系统管理任务
确认启动crond系统服务
每周一早上7:50自动清空FTP服务器公共目录“/var/ftp/pub”
每天晚上10:30分自动执行任务,保存磁盘使用情况信息
查看所设置的计划任务列表
补充:
除了“*”,还可以使用减号“-”、逗号“,”、斜杠“/”与数字构成表达式来表示复杂的时间关系:
使用减号“-”可以表示一个连续的时间范围,如“1-4”表示整数1,2,3,4
使用逗号“,”可以表示一个间隔的不连续范围,如“3, 4, 6, 8”
斜杠符号“/”可以用来指定间隔频率,如在日期字段中的“*/3”表示每隔3天